Common Admission Requirements For Pharmacy Technology SchoolsIn Indio, California

When considering Pharmacy Technology programs in Indio, California, students should be aware of the common admission requirements:

  • High School Diploma or Equivalent: Most programs require a high school diploma or GED. This foundational education is necessary for understanding advanced concepts in pharmacy studies.

  • Prerequisite Coursework: Some programs may require students to have completed courses in biology, chemistry, or mathematics. These subjects help build essential knowledge for understanding pharmaceutical drugs and their effects.

  • Online Application: Prospective students typically need to complete an application form, which can often be submitted online.

  • Entrance Exam: Some school programs may require passing an entrance exam, which assesses math and reading comprehension skills.

  • Background Check and Drug Screening: Due to the nature of the work, students may need to undergo a background check and drug screening as part of the enrollment process.

  • Certification Expectations: It’s advisable for students to plan to take the Pharmacy Technician Certification Exam (PTCE) after graduation, as many employers prefer certified pharmacy technicians.

Cost & Financial Aid Options For Pharmacy Technology Schools In Indio, California

The cost of Pharmacy Technology programs in Indio varies depending on the institution and type of program. Here’s what to anticipate:

  • Tuition Costs:

    • Certificate programs can range from $3,000 to $15,000, while associate degree programs may cost $10,000 to $25,000.
    • Additional costs include textbooks, uniforms, and lab fees.
  • Financial Aid Options:

    • Federal Financial Aid: Students can apply for the FAFSA (Free Application for Federal Student Aid) which may provide access to grants, work-study, and loans.
    • State Grants and Scholarships: California offers various grants and scholarships for vocational students, including the Cal Grant.
    • Institution-Specific Scholarships: Many colleges and technical schools offer their own scholarships based on merit or financial need.
  • Payment Plans: Some schools provide flexible payment plans, allowing students to pay tuition in installments rather than all at once.

  • Work-Study Programs: Many institutions may have work-study programs that enable students to work part-time while attending school to offset tuition costs.

Pharmacy Technician Salary in California
Annual Median: $49,880
Hourly Median: $23.98
Data sourced from Career One Stop, provided by the BLS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ics wage estimates.
PercentileAnnual Salary
10th$38,370
25th$45,730
Median$49,880
75th$63,280
90th$77,600

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) About Pharmacy Technology Schools In Indio, California

  1. What is the duration of Pharmacy Technology programs in Indio?

    • Most certificate programs take about 6-12 months, while associate degree programs typically last 2 years.
  2. Are online Pharmacy Technology courses available?

    • Yes, some institutions offer hybrid or fully online pharmacy technician programs.
  3. What is the average salary for a pharmacy technician in California?

    • As of the latest data, pharmacy technicians in California typically earn between $40,000 and $50,000 annually, depending on experience and location.
  4. Do I need to be certified to work as a pharmacy technician?

    • Certification is not mandatory, but many employers prefer it. Passing the PTCE can enhance job prospects.
  5. Is there clinical training included in Pharmacy Technology programs?

    • Yes, programs usually include hands-on clinical training or externships to gain practical experience.
  6. What skills do pharmacy technicians need?

    • Key skills include attention to detail, strong communication, customer service, and knowledge of medical terminology.
  7. Are there job placements after completing the Pharmacy Technology program?

    • Many schools have job placement programs and partnerships with local pharmacies and hospitals to assist graduates.
  8. Can I specialize in a certain area within pharmacy technology?

    • Yes, after gaining experience, pharmacy technicians can specialize in fields like compounding or hazardous drugs.
  9. What continuing education is required for pharmacy technicians?

    • California requires pharmacy technicians to complete 20 hours of continuing education every two years to maintain their license.
  10. How do I choose the right Pharmacy Technology program?

    • Consider factors like accreditation, job placement rates, program length, and cost when selecting a program.
